He watched silently, his eyes shutting against her misplaced shot. Luckily "You did good. Very good." He would assure Rexanna in a calm, reassuring tone before he took the bow and another arrow from her gently as he began following the buck. The bow held steady in his hands, Alistair place an arrow into the back of the skull, severing the spinal column as well. The buck would fall limp, ending it's fleeting life. Hunting knife slipped free from its hold on his belt as he walked over to fallen creature. He proceeded to gut the buck, skin it, clean it. All handled with respect for the animal they had taken. During which he allowed Rexanna to plunge her hands into the filth and learn how a hunter truly claimed their game. Afterwards, the meat and skins would be taken to the settlement for trade, and to the tavern to keep Vervain's menu full. It was then, they had parted ways. The last two days served as a fun diversion, one he looked to experience again, but truly he still had much to accept and learn about himself before he allowed himself to be disarmed once again. Rexanna was nothing short of invigorating, a shot of life when he needed it most. Had their paths crossed again he would welcome it without hesitation. Had these days been the extent of their interaction, it was a memory worth savoring when he questioned if he were ever able to simply allow himself to live free. {End Thread} |
